    Motorola’s Moto X Force smartphone available at retail chains in India.

    US technology firm Motorola Mobility on Thursday announced to make Moto X Force smartphone available at retail chains in India.

    The phone will be available in Flipkart, Amazon and Snapdeal, Moto X Force and it will now debut across leading retail stores in general trade and large format chains like Croma, Spice Hotspot, Vijay Sales and Poorvika in India, the company said in a statement.

    Priced at Rs.49,999 for 32GB variant on Flipkart and Amazon, the device can be bought from over 400 retail stores across 15 cities with easy EMI options on select bank credit cards.

    The Moto X Force smartphone features Moto ShatterShield — the world’s first shatterproof smartphone ultra hi-resolution 5.4-inch Quad HD AMOLED display.

    The device is packed with the powerful Qualcomm Snapdragon 810 processor with octa-core CPUs, 3GB RAM and features a 21-megapixel rear camera with rapid focus and a 5-megapixel front-facing camera with flash for selfies.

    It has a 3,760mAh battery and features TurboPower charging that gives up to eight hours of battery life after just 15 minutes of charging.

    The Moto X Force comes with 32GB/64GB internal storage and supports an external storage of up to 2TB.
